Get immersed in the world of a historical time and place, and then engage with a scholar to learn the “real” story. May 25's virtual session features Joseph Andras’ Tomorrow They Won’t Dare To Murder Us, winner of the Prix Goncourt for first novel, one of the most prestigious literary awards in France. Set during the Algerian War of Independence, the novel is based on the true story of a young man named Fernand Iveton and a young politician named François Mitterrand. The program will be facilitated by Jennifer Sessions, an Associate Professor of History and Director of Undergraduate Studies at the University of Virginia, and co-sponsored by the Princeton Public Library.
